Swedish central bank's Thedeen says inflation risks have increased, pointing to Middle East conflict
STOCKHOLM, April 22 (Reuters) - Swedish central bank Governor Erik Thedeen said on Wednesday the risk has risen somewhat that inflation could be higher than the Riksbank expected a few weeks ago.
